User-Focused Analytics
Mixpanel offers detailed insights into user behavior, enabling businesses to understand how users interact with their product, which helps in making data-driven decisions.
Event Tracking
The platform allows for precise event tracking, providing real-time analysis of user actions and conversions, which is helpful for optimizing user experience and marketing strategies.
Advanced Segmentation
Mixpanel's advanced segmentation capabilities help in understanding various user groups, enabling personalized marketing campaigns and enhanced user engagement.
A/B Testing
The built-in A/B testing feature allows for experimenting with different variations of features and interfaces to determine what works best for users.
Custom Dashboards
Users can create customizable dashboards to monitor key metrics and KPIs, making it easier to keep track of important data and trends.

Mixpanel is a product analytics tool that provides product managers with real-time insights into user behavior, helping them make more informed decisions with instant access to their data. It enables detailed event tracking, such as button clicks and page views, across both web and mobile applications. Mixpanel has great documentation for setting up your project in many different languages, including JavaScript. They also provide docs and examples for implenting tracking with a proxy. Setting up Mixpanel through a proxy is useful to bypass ad and tracking blockers, and is a nice way to keep all client requests through your domain. - Source: dev.to / about 3 years ago
